Why Your Cover Letter Matters for an Administrative Officer Role

Think of your cover letter as your personal introduction to the hiring manager. It’s not just a formality; it’s a vital tool that complements your resume. A well-written cover letter can highlight specific skills and experiences that directly relate to the Administrative Officer job description, showing them why you’re the perfect fit. The importance of a tailored cover letter cannot be overstated. Here’s what makes a great Administrative Officer cover letter:
  • It directly addresses the job requirements mentioned in the advertisement.
  • It showcases your understanding of the organization you’re applying to.
  • It demonstrates your communication skills and attention to detail.
Here’s a quick breakdown of key sections to include:
  1. Your Contact Information: Make sure it's clear and accurate.
  2. Date: The date you're sending the letter.
  3. Hiring Manager's Contact Information: If you know it, use it!
  4. Salutation: Address it to a specific person if possible (e.g., "Dear Ms. Smith").
  5. Opening Paragraph: State the position you're applying for and where you saw the advertisement.
  6. Body Paragraphs: This is where you shine! Link your skills and experiences to the job duties. Use examples.
  7. Closing Paragraph: Reiterate your interest and express your eagerness for an interview.
  8. Closing: A professional closing like "Sincerely."
  9. Your Typed Name: Followed by your signature if sending a hard copy.

Cover Letter Sample For Job Application Administrative Officer - Standard Application

[Your Name] [Your Address] [Your Phone Number] [Your Email Address] [Date] [Hiring Manager Name (if known)] [Hiring Manager Title] [Company Name] [Company Address] Dear [Mr./Ms./Mx. Last Name or Hiring Manager], I am writing to express my enthusiastic interest in the Administrative Officer position at [Company Name], as advertised on [Platform where you saw the ad]. With my str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proven ability to manage diverse administrative tasks, I am confident that I possess the qualifications necessary to excel in this role and contribute positively to your team. In my previous role at [Previous Company Name], I was responsible for [mention 2-3 key duties that align with the Administrative Officer role, e.g., managing calendars, coordinating meetings, preparing reports, and handling correspondence]. I consistently demonstrated an ability to prioritize tasks effectively, maintain accurate records, and provide seamless support to management and staff. For example, I successfully implemented a new filing system that improved document retrieval efficiency by 15%. I am particularly drawn to [Company Name]'s commitment to [mention something specific about the company that appeals to you, e.g., innovation in the tech sector, community engagement, customer service excellence]. I am eager to apply my skills in a dynamic environment and believe my proactive approach and dedication to efficient operations would be a valuable asset to your organization. Thank you for considering my application. I have attached my resume for your review and welcome the opportunity to discuss how my skills and experience can benefit [Company Name] in an interview. Sincerely, [Your Typed Name]
